Unified API has emerged as a game-changer in the realm of software development and business operations, addressing the integration challenges that businesses face when striving to seamlessly integrate various systems and platforms. But what exactly is a Unified API? How does it benefit organizations, and what should you know about it? Here, we'll delve into the essentials of Unified APIs, exploring their significance and answering key questions.
1. What is Unified API
- A Unified API, or Application Programming Interface, is a single, standardized interface that allows multiple software applications to communicate with each other.
- Instead of dealing with multiple APIs for different services, a Unified API provides a cohesive way to access various functionalities, simplifying integration and improving efficiency.
- It consolidates various APIs into one, offering a more streamlined approach to managing interactions between different software systems.
2. The Power of Integration
- One of the primary benefits of a Unified API is its ability to merge different systems seamlessly.
- For instance, a Unified API can integrate customer relationship management (CRM) systems, payment gateways, and e-commerce platforms into a single interface.
- This integration ensures that data flows smoothly between these systems, enhancing operational efficiency and providing a more holistic view of business processes.
3. Unified Payments API
- In the realm of financial transactions, a Unified Payments API plays a crucial role. It provides a single interface for processing payments across various platforms, including credit cards, digital wallets, and bank transfers.
- This unification simplifies payment processing, reduces errors, and enhances the customer experience by offering multiple payment options through a single API.
4. What is Unified Commerce API?
- Unified Commerce API refers to an API that integrates various commerce-related functionalities into a single interface.
- This includes inventory management, order processing, customer data management, and more.
- By consolidating these functions, a Unified Commerce API helps businesses streamline their operations, improve customer satisfaction, and gain insights from a centralized data repository.
5. Streamlining Communication with Unified Communications Managed API
- Unified Communications Managed API is another significant aspect of Unified APIs. It integrates various communication tools such as email, instant messaging, video conferencing, and VoIP into a single interface.
- This unification allows businesses to manage all their communication channels efficiently, ensuring that employees can collaborate seamlessly regardless of their location.
6. Enhanced Security and Compliance
- Unified APIs also enhance security and compliance. By providing a single point of access, they enable better control over data flow and access permissions.
- This centralized management reduces the risk of data breaches and ensures that compliance requirements are consistently met across all integrated systems.
7. Simplified Development and Maintenance
- For developers, a Unified API simplifies the process of creating and maintaining integrations.
- Instead of writing and managing code for multiple APIs, developers can focus on a single interface.
- This not only reduces development time but also makes maintenance easier, as updates and changes only need to be implemented once.
8. Improved Scalability
- Unified APIs are designed to be scalable. As businesses grow and their integration needs evolve, a Unified API can easily accommodate new systems and functionalities.
- This scalability ensures that organizations can continue to leverage the benefits of a unified approach without facing integration challenges as they expand.
9. Real-Time Data Access
- With a Unified API, businesses can access real-time data from various integrated systems.
- This real-time access enables better decision-making, as stakeholders have up-to-date information at their fingertips.
- Whether it's monitoring inventory levels, tracking sales performance, or analyzing customer behavior, a Unified API provides the necessary data for informed decision-making.
10. Cost Efficiency
- Finally, a Unified API can lead to significant cost savings. By reducing the need for multiple integrations and simplifying development and maintenance, businesses can lower their operational costs.
- Additionally, the improved efficiency and streamlined processes result in better resource utilization, further contributing to cost savings.
Unified APIs represent a significant advancement in the world of software integration. By providing a single, standardized interface for multiple systems, they streamline operations, enhance security, and improve scalability. Whether it's a Unified Payments API for financial transactions, a Unified Commerce API for managing commerce-related functions, or a Unified Communications Managed API for communication tools, the benefits of a unified approach are clear.
As businesses continue to seek ways to integrate their systems more efficiently, the importance of Unified APIs will only grow. For those looking to explore the possibilities of Unified APIs and leverage their benefits, platforms like Klamp, an embedded iPaaS platform, offer the perfect solution. Klamp enables seamless integration of various applications, providing a robust and scalable approach to managing business processes